Avondale Estates is a small city that takes its kids seriously, and that is exactly how we coach. Families here tell us they want a program close to home where their athlete is known by name, not by roster number. That is the whole point of the Diamond Eagles.
Our season runs from summer evaluations through spring championships, with practices scheduled around school nights so homework still gets done. Avondale athletes typically train two to three evenings a week during the competitive season.

Competitive Cheer
Our core program. Athletes learn motions, jumps, stunting, tumbling, dance, and choreography while competing at CHEERSPORT and Varsity events.
Tumbling
Progressive tumbling instruction from basic rolls to advanced passes. Builds the foundation for competitive routines and individual skill growth.
Stunting
Partner and group stunting fundamentals through advanced techniques. Athletes learn trust, timing, and teamwork through every lift.
Strength Training
Age-appropriate conditioning that builds the power behind every stunt, tumble, and jump. Functional fitness for athletic performance.
Leadership
Our Diamond Leadership Track teaches public speaking, goal setting, financial literacy, and community service project management for athletes 13+.
Conditioning
Off-season and in-season conditioning programs that build endurance, flexibility, and injury resilience.
Competition Teams
Organized by age and level (Mini, Youth, Junior, Senior). Teams compete at local and regional CHEERSPORT and Varsity events throughout the season.
Private Lessons
One-on-one and small group instruction tailored to individual skill development. Available by appointment for athletes who want accelerated progress.
Summer Camps
Week-long day camps combining cheer fundamentals, team building, leadership workshops, and fun. Open to all skill levels, ages 5–17.
Clinics
Focused skill clinics throughout the year — tumbling, stunting, tryout prep, and conditioning boot camps. Drop-in friendly, no season commitment required.
Mentorship
Senior athletes mentor younger team members through our Junior Coaching Program. Building the next generation of leaders, on and off the mat.
Community Service
Every Diamond Eagle contributes to their community. Athletes participate in service projects, volunteering, and outreach throughout the season.
